logo

Output 37c03621411af0973a22dca4b1175562ae9feaa57c4665d8c316960eb4ec1445:1

value
68321244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256148d61220ae3dfe62d865361de4e78ba04eeb OP_EQUAL
address
356fU64uSTydGcu87cBEnLtSDseVA785KV
transaction
37c03621411af0973a22dca4b1175562ae9feaa57c4665d8c316960eb4ec1445